| #ifndef _INTEL_COMMON_SMI_H_ |
| #define _INTEL_COMMON_SMI_H_ |
| |
| /* |
| * The register value is used with get_reg and set_reg |
| */ |
| enum smm_reg { |
| RAX, |
| RBX, |
| RCX, |
| RDX, |
| }; |
| |
| |
| struct smm_save_state_ops { |
| /* return io_misc_info from SMM Save State Area */ |
| uint32_t (*get_io_misc_info)(void *state); |
| |
| /* return value of the requested register from |
| * SMM Save State Area |
| */ |
| uint64_t (*get_reg)(void *state, enum smm_reg reg); |
| |
| void (*set_reg)(void *state, enum smm_reg reg, uint64_t val); |
| }; |
| |
| typedef void (*smi_handler_t)(const struct smm_save_state_ops *save_state_ops); |
| |
| /* |
| * SOC SMI Handler has to provide this structure which has methods to access |
| * the SOC specific SMM Save State Area |
| */ |
| const struct smm_save_state_ops *get_smm_save_state_ops(void); |
| |
| /* |
| * southbridge_smi should be defined inside SOC specific code and should have |
| * handlers for any SMI events that need to be handled. Default handlers |
| * for some SMI events are provided in soc/intel/common/smihandler.c |
| */ |
| extern const smi_handler_t southbridge_smi[32]; |
| |
| /* |
| * This function should be implemented in SOC specific code to handle |
| * the SMI event on SLP_EN. The default functionality is provided in |
| * soc/intel/common/smihandler.c |
| */ |
| void southbridge_smi_sleep(const struct smm_save_state_ops *save_state_ops); |
